Hey Priya,

Quick handover before the sync. The GiftNote donation-receipt mailer is mostly self-running now — it pulls confirmed donations nightly, renders PDFs, and queues them through Plumefeed. Two gotchas: the retry table bloats if Plumefeed hiccups (just truncate anything older than 7 days), and the template cache needs a manual flush after any schema change. Cron runs at 02:15. Everything else is documented in the runbook. To poke at the mailer database directly, connect using the following.

Cheers,
Dario

replica DSN, kajep-yahag: mssql://praok_svc:iF@db-8d68.plorvaio.local:5432/eliion

Q: Why does the Murwick Gallery audio-guide app re-download tour packs after every update?

A: Pack checksums are tied to the app version, so any release invalidates the cache. This is intentional until the Relic sync service ships delta updates. If a pack fails to download on gallery Wi-Fi, report the exhibit code to the content team at the address below.

alerts address for bawif-hahig: norwyn_gorys_lamath@olvarqlabs.test

Sweepwell, our data-retention sweeper, ships on a four-week cadence from the `release` branch. Every build is reproducible: the CI pipeline pins toolchain versions and emits a manifest alongside each artifact. Before publishing, the release manager signs the manifest so downstream installers can verify provenance. New team members should never distribute unsigned builds, even for internal testing, because the sweeper touches deletion policies in production. To verify a downloaded release, check it against the signing key that follows.

deploy key for kajof-fajop: bky6_gDHw9Q

Subject: Dark mode on the Ledgerview admin dashboard

Hi — since you're joining the on-call rotation, a quick note on dark-mode support. All colors come from the theme token layer; direct hex values in components will fail review. The toggle persists per user and falls back to the OS preference. Most reported bugs are contrast issues in charts, which live in a separate package. When reviewing changes, run the visual diff job before approving. The token reference and review checklist are maintained here:

wiki page, fahaf-yagag: https://confluence.qorvellabs.internal/pages/display/pages/display